I think you misunderstand how 99% of documentaries work. It's not that Netflix is the only one making documentaries these days, it's that Netflix is the only company buying them all up and distributing them. Very few documentaries are funded by broadcasting corps in the first place then filmed and distributed after the fact. Usually small documentary teams film their doc then shop it around to broadcasters who will buy and sometimes re-edit them. For decades that was the realm of networks like the BBC and Discovery and others but now it's all streaming services, mostly Netflix.
